Some peers seem to defer DELETEs a few seconds after rekeying the IKE_SA, which
is perfectly valid. For short(er) DPD delays, this leads to the situation where
we send a DPD request during set_state(), but the IKE_SA has no hosts set yet.
Avoid that DPD by resetting the INBOUND timestamp during set_state().
The child_updown() function sets up environment variables to the updown
script. Sometimes call to hydra->kernel_interface->get_interface() could
fail and iface variable could be left uninitialized. This patch fixes
this issue by passing "unknown" as interface name.

An rwlock wait is not a thread cancellation point. As a canceled thread
would not have released the mutex, the rwlock would have been left in unusable
state.
Depending on the value of the CVPN3000-IPSec-Split-Tunneling-Policy(55)
radius attribute, the subnets in the CVPN3000-IPSec-Split-Tunnel-List(27)
attribute are sent in either a UNITY_SPLIT_INCLUDE (if the value is 1)
or a UNITY_LOCAL_LAN (if the value is 2).
So if the following attributes would be configured for a RADIUS user
CVPN3000-IPSec-Split-Tunnel-List := "10.0.1.0/255.255.255.0,10.0.2.0/255.255.255.0"
CVPN3000-IPSec-Split-Tunneling-Policy := 1
A UNITY_SPLIT_INCLUDE configuration payload containing these two subnets
would be sent to the client during the ModeCfg exchange.
The contents of the CVPN3000-IPSec-Default-Domain(28) and
CVPN3000-IPSec-Split-DNS-Names(29) radius attributes are forwarded in
the corresponding Unity configuration attributes.
Add DNSSEC protected CERT RR delivered certificate authentication.
The new dnscert plugin is based on the ipseckey plugin and relies on the
existing PEM decoder as well as x509 and PGP parsers. As such the plugin
expects PEM encoded PKIX(x509) or PGP(GPG) certificate payloads.
The plugin is targeted to improve interoperability with Racoon, which
supports this type of authentication, ignoring in-stream certificates
and using only DNS provided certificates for FQDN IDs.
